Unsupervised Classification of Spike Patterns with the Loihi Neuromorphic Processor

被引:0
|
作者
Matsuo, Ryoga [1 ]
Elgaradiny, Ahmed [1 ]
Corradi, Federico [1 ]
机构
[1] Eindhoven Univ Technol, Dept Elect Engn, POB 513, NL-5600 MB Eindhoven, Netherlands
关键词
neuromorphic computing; unsupervised learning; spiking neural networks; working memory; attractor dynamics; NEURAL-NETWORKS; WORKING-MEMORY; ON-CHIP; ARCHITECTURE; SPINNAKER;
D O I
10.3390/electronics13163203
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
A long-standing research goal is to develop computing technologies that mimic the brain's capabilities by implementing computation in electronic systems directly inspired by its structure, function, and operational mechanisms, using low-power, spike-based neural networks. The Loihi neuromorphic processor provides a low-power, large-scale network of programmable silicon neurons for brain-inspired artificial intelligence applications. This paper exploits the Loihi processors and a theory-guided methodology to enable unsupervised learning of spike patterns. Our method ensures efficient and rapid selection of the network's hyperparameters, enabling the neuromorphic processor to generate attractor states through real-time unsupervised learning. Precisely, we follow a fast design process in which we fine-tune network parameters using mean-field theory. Moreover, we measure the network's learning ability regarding its error correction and pattern completion aptitude. Finally, we observe the dynamic energy consumption of the neuron cores for each millisecond of simulation equal to 23 mu J/time step during the learning and recall phase for four attractors composed of 512 excitatory neurons and 256 shared inhibitory neurons. This study showcases how large-scale, low-power digital neuromorphic processors can be quickly programmed to enable the autonomous generation of attractor states. These attractors are fundamental computational primitives that theoretical analysis and experimental evidence indicate as versatile and reusable components suitable for a wide range of cognitive tasks.
引用
下载
收藏
页数:22
相关论文
共 50 条
  • [22] Skimming Digits: Neuromorphic Classification of Spike-Encoded Images
    Cohen, Gregory K.
    Orchard, Garrick
    Leng, Sio-Hoi
    Tapson, Jonathan
    Benosman, Ryad B.
    van Schaik, Andre
    FRONTIERS IN NEUROSCIENCE, 2016, 10
  • [23] Unsupervised Learning and Adaptive Classification of Neuromorphic Tactile Encoding of Textures
    Iskarous, Mark M.
    Nguyen, Harrison H.
    Osborn, Luke E.
    Betthauser, Joseph L.
    Thakor, Nitish V.
    2018 IEEE BIOMEDICAL CIRCUITS AND SYSTEMS CONFERENCE (BIOCAS): ADVANCED SYSTEMS FOR ENHANCING HUMAN HEALTH, 2018, : 619 - 622
  • [24] Advancing Neuromorphic Computing With Loihi: A Survey of Results and Outlook
    Davies, Mike
    Wild, Andreas
    Orchard, Garrick
    Sandamirskaya, Yulia
    Guerra, Gabriel A. Fonseca
    Joshi, Prasad
    Plank, Philipp
    Risbud, Sumedh R.
    PROCEEDINGS OF THE IEEE, 2021, 109 (05) : 911 - 934
  • [25] A Neuromorphic Neural Spike Clustering Processor for Deep-Brain Sensing and Stimulation Systems
    Zhang, Beinuo
    Jiang, Zhewei
    Wang, Qi
    Seo, Jae-Sun
    Seok, Mingoo
    2015 IEEE/ACM INTERNATIONAL SYMPOSIUM ON LOW POWER ELECTRONICS AND DESIGN (ISLPED), 2015, : 91 - 97
  • [26] A 65-nm Neuromorphic Image Classification Processor With Energy-Efficient Training Through Direct Spike-Only Feedback
    Park, Jeongwoo
    Lee, Juyun
    Jeon, Dongsuk
    IEEE JOURNAL OF SOLID-STATE CIRCUITS, 2020, 55 (01) : 108 - 119
  • [27] Decoding of naturalistic textures from spike patterns of neuromorphic artificial mechanoreceptors
    Alberto Mazzoni
    Udaya B Rongala
    Calogero M Oddo
    BMC Neuroscience, 16 (Suppl 1)
  • [28] Neuromorphic Tactile Edge Orientation Classification in an Unsupervised Spiking Neural Network
    Macdonald, Fraser L. A.
    Lepora, Nathan F.
    Conradt, Jorg
    Ward-Cherrier, Benjamin
    SENSORS, 2022, 22 (18)
  • [29] Brian2Loihi: An emulator for the neuromorphic chip Loihi using the spiking neural network simulator Brian
    Michaelis, Carlo
    Lehr, Andrew B.
    Oed, Winfried
    Tetzlaff, Christian
    FRONTIERS IN NEUROINFORMATICS, 2022, 16
  • [30] SPIKE RECOGNITION AND ONLINE CLASSIFICATION BY UNSUPERVISED LEARNING-SYSTEM
    DHOLLANDER, EH
    ORBAN, GA
    IEEE TRANSACTIONS ON BIOMEDICAL ENGINEERING, 1979, 26 (05) : 279 - 284